Thyroid nodules can indicate thyroid cancer or other thyroid malignancies. A fine needle aspiration biopsy (FNA biopsy) is a minimally invasive procedure used by ENT specialists to identify thyroid cancer cells, assess the size of the nodule, and determine if surgical removal is necessary. The American Thyroid Association states this method is vital in diagnosing thyroid cancer and may prevent unnecessary surgery. If inconclusive results are obtained, a core needle biopsy or repeat FNA may be necessary. Biopsy outcomes also inform the appropriateness of thyroid hormone therapy, radioactive iodine treatment, or other thyroid cancer treatment options. Patients may experience minor side effects at the biopsy site, especially if on blood thinners. Despite the small size of the tissue sample, biopsy results provide critical insight, especially when evaluating symptoms in the lower neck, lymph nodes, or the back of the thyroid.

Why Thyroid Biopsies Matter in ENT Care

When a patient presents with a thyroid nodule or neck swelling, ENT specialists play a vital role in determining whether the mass is benign or malignant. A thyroid biopsy, often the first diagnostic step, provides essential insight into cellular changes and helps guide treatment decisions.

What Happens During a Thyroid Biopsy?

A thyroid biopsy is a key step in evaluating suspicious nodules in the thyroid gland, especially when cancer is a concern. ENT specialists typically perform this procedure to gather a small but vital tissue sample that can reveal the nature of the growth. Here’s what patients can expect during the process.

Fine Needle Aspiration (FNA)

The most common technique used is fine needle aspiration. This minimally invasive procedure involves inserting a thin needle into the thyroid nodule to extract a small sample of tissue or fluid. ENT providers often perform this under ultrasound guidance to ensure accuracy.

What the Sample Reveals

Once collected, the tissue is sent to a cytopathologist who examines the cells for signs of cancer. The pathologist assesses cellular structure, growth patterns, and nuclear features to identify malignancies such as papillary thyroid carcinoma, follicular neoplasm, or medullary thyroid cancer.

Signs That May Lead to a Biopsy Referral

ENT providers may recommend a thyroid biopsy if patients present with:

  • Neck fullness or a visible mass in the anterior neck region.
  • Voice changes or hoarseness due to compression of the recurrent laryngeal nerve.
  • Difficulty swallowing (dysphagia) linked to a growing thyroid nodule.
  • Persistent sore throat or neck pain without clear infection.
  • Abnormal ultrasound findings, such as microcalcifications or irregular margins.

Accuracy and Limitations

While FNA offers high diagnostic accuracy, it’s not infallible. Some samples return as “indeterminate,” requiring repeat biopsy or molecular testing. For inconclusive results, ENT surgeons may consider diagnostic lobectomy for further histopathological evaluation.

The Role of the ENT in Multidisciplinary Care

Thyroid cancer diagnosis isn’t made in isolation. ENT specialists collaborate closely with endocrinologists, radiologists, and oncologists to determine the most appropriate course—whether it’s watchful waiting, surgery, or additional imaging.
